
Blush placement significantly impacts facial appearance, with higher placement on the cheekbones offering a transformative effect. Applying blush higher, closer to the temples, can create a lifted, slimmer, and more balanced look by drawing the eye upward and outward. Conversely, low blush placement near the mouth can make the face appear shorter, wider, and heavier, potentially emphasizing lines and making the face seem tired. Higher blush placement also enhances natural highlights, creating the illusion of higher cheekbones and a more angular mid-face, benefiting various face shapes like round and square by softening features and reducing perceived width.
